not sure where I am posting this but please someone help me, i'm at my wits end with this problem, took my car out, ran a quarter mile in it, brought it back to the house and shut it down, car set for 3 hours, went out and started car up and backed it back in shop, went out next morning to start it and it turns over but no start, I checked and found there is no spark, I went as far as to change optic spark distributor again, change coil, changed crankshaft sensor, still got the same problem, if I have no spark, is there any chance that I have messed up the timming and if so how would I check or is there a way to check without disassembling the engine, thanks guys for reading this book, but please help if you can, also sorry if this post has be put in wrong place

Re: no spark on my LT1
Did you check the ICM module? If that isn't working, you won't get spark.

Re: no spark on my LT1
before I start beating on coil do I drill the posts out of the coil bracket or do they punch out Thanks
Reply
Aug 19, 2014 | 04:42 PM
  #4  
Re: no spark on my LT1
The coil is attached to the ICM bracket with rivets. Drill them out. A replacement coil may come with small bolts to reinstall it.
